The Role

We are seeking full-time Analysts to join our Private Credit team in the summer of 2026. This role will be based in our Boston office.

The ideal candidates will have a strong academic record with prior internship experience in investing. Applicants should exhibit the following skills and/or experiences:

  • Strong academic credentials and a demonstrated track record of successful work experience

  • Self-driven and intellectually curious

  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ships and influence effectively

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ving capabilities

Throughout the analyst program you will:

  • Conduct deep, company-specific research, including attending management meetings, on-site diligence with customers and suppliers, and attend relevant industry conferences

  • Perform industry-level analyses to inform the investment process and provide critical context

  • Develop detailed financial models, including earnings projections and valuation analyses, to inform investment decisions

  • Generate thoughtful, proactive buy/sell recommendations and communicate investment theses clearly to the team

The Credit Analyst opportunity is available only to students who are currently in an undergraduate program.

Bain Capital Overview

With approximately $185 billion of assets under management, Bain Capital is one of the world’s leading private investment firms. We create lasting impact for our investors, teams, businesses, and the communities in which we live. Over four decades we have strategically grown our platform to focus on Private Equity, Growth & Venture, Capital Solutions, Credit & Capital Markets, and Real Assets. Today, our team includes 1,880+ employees in 24 offices on four continents.

Bain Capital Credit Overview

Bain Capital Credit is a leading global credit specialist with approximately $54 billion in assets under management as of March 31, 2025. We invest across the full spectrum of credit strategies, including leveraged loans, high-yield bonds, direct lending, structured products, non-performing loans, and equities. Through our numerous funds, we have the ability to invest in every level of a company’s capital structure from secured debt to equity, and we can also provide capital to growing companies with unique financing needs.

Bain Capital Credit’s Private Credit Group evaluates investment opportunities across the spectrum in the middle market, or typically companies with $25-75M of EBITDA located in North America, Europe, and Asia Pacific.  With a dedicated global team of 25+ investment professionals, we are actively looking to lead or participate in senior, second lien and unitranche loans; subordinated debt; and preferred or common equity co-investments for traditional leveraged buyout transactions and non-sponsored financings.  We place considerable emphasis on investing in leading companies with talented management teams and aim to provide a tailored solution to every unique opportunity by having considerable flexibility when structuring terms.  We can hold up to $200 million in any middle market transaction and can grow with a borrower into a broadly syndicated structure through our liquid credit strategies. 

Bain Capital Credit has a world-class team of over 100 investment professionals with extensive experience analyzing and managing high-yield investments.
